Billy Eichner’s upcoming movie “Bros” could do lots to educate straights about romantic lives of gays

I kind of don’t mind that Bros isn’t coming out until Sept. 30 if it means I’m going to get terrific interview with Billy Eichner leading up the the release.

In a new article on RollingStone.com, Eichner shares how he had to educate the film’s director and co-writer Nick Stoller about gay men.

“We have our own rules about what’s ethical or not ethical, in terms of dating and commitment and monogamy,” Eichner says. “And two men together is a very unique, specific romantic situation. Because yes, we’re gay. But, as I often tell my straight friends, we’re still men. I think straight people think we’re basically women. We are men! I always say to my straight male friends, ‘Think about all the weird, fucked-up male shit you have in your brain about sex and monogamy and being vulnerable. Now times that by two.’ That’s going to be a very complicated situation, and we’ve really never seen it explored.”

“I’m in my forties,” Eichner adds. “I look around at movies in general — about straight people, about gay people — especially comedies, and say, ‘Where are the adults?’ I grew up with those great James L. Brooks movies and Nora Ephron movies. They really made me fall in love with movies. And they have disappeared entirely.”

The Covid delay allowed for extra time in the writing process, which had the occasional speed bump.

“Nick has been in a marriage a very long time,” says Eichner. “Marriage and family, in the very heteronormative sense, is very, very important to him. Whereas gay men make up our own rules, we create our own families. The one time I got mad at Nick, and I hope he’s OK with me saying this, we were thinking about Bobby’s arc in the movie, and he said to me, ‘If you’re 40 and you’re single, there has to be something wrong with you.’ And I exploded. I got so mad! I think that’s an old-fashioned notion even for younger straight couples. They’re polyamorous and they’re this and they’re that.”
